March 21, 2013 1st ever AWT (Alliance for Working Together) Foundation Event

McNeil Industries hosted its 1st ever AWT (Alliance for Working Together) Foundation Event with 24 Seventh Grade students from Madison Middle School on Thursday, March 21, 2013.  Many of the students were very intrigued and impressed with the facility and asked insightful questions about where McNeil’s parts are used in their everyday lives.  They were visually able to explore our facility and have it change their perception of what manufacturing is all about.

February 1, 2013 2013 LEAN Initiative

McNeil Industries is pleased to announce the kickoff of the 2013 LEAN initiative. After receiving 56 hours of training from Innovative Quality Services Company’s President Michael Mathe, the newly formed steering committee will embark on the first of many LEAN initiative projects designed to increase performance while reducing waste. LEAN training for most of McNeil’s employees will continue in the weeks ahead, laying the foundation for the success of the initiative. Each of the projects selected from the “project hopper” are ideas chosen by the steering committee that possess significant improvement capability and will be addressed by the LEAN team members using the systematic approach of “DMAIC” which stands for Define, Measure, Analyze, Improve and Control. DMAIC is the core of LEAN and will be applied to every project as the initiative progresses. The success of the initiative and the benefits of each project will be shared in the months ahead.

August 1, 2013 - Appointment of Robert E. Madden as Vice President, Business Development

August 1, 2013 - Appointment of Robert E. Madden as Vice President, Business Development, was announced by Justin J. McNeil, President and COO of McNeil Industries, Painesville, Ohio.  The company manufactures and distributes MAXAM® Bearings, Guide Systems, industrial seals, and precision manufactured products in various industries including Aerospace.

In this role, Madden will drive McNeil Industries aerospace sales, marketing, and support programs, strengthen its strategic accounts program, and identify and evaluate new product or market opportunities.
